How does the recovery and storage of oil booms work?

The deployment of oil booms can be divided into two situations: long-term deployment and temporary deployment. There is no frequent recycling problem for long-term deployment. Generally, the temporary deployment of oil booms involves recovery, cleaning, maintenance, and storage. This section introduces the operation steps and precautions for the recovery, cleaning, maintenance and storage of oil booms.


1. Recovery operation of oil boom

The recovery of oil boom is the reverse operation of deployment. The recovery operation of the solid float oil boom is relatively simple, but the recovery speed is slow; the recovery operation of the inflatable oil boom is relatively easy. The main steps of the recovery operation are as follows:

1)The auxiliary tug boat first untie the tow rope of the oil boom, so that the oil boom is only connected to the main tug to tow;

2)According to the water area, the main tug should sail against the current, so that the oil boom is deployed in a straight line behind the stern of the ship

3)Use a winch or oil boom winding frame to slowly drag the oil boom onto the deck or wind it on the winding frame;

4)During the recovery process, the inflatable oil boom needs to release the gas in the air chamber while recovering, and save the air chamber cover;

5)Check whether the oil boom is damaged during the winding process and make a record.


2. Matters needing attention during the recycling process

1)Pay attention to safety during the recovery process of the oil boom. The oil boom will be very slippery, which increases the difficulty of the recovery operation, it will also stain the equipment and operators, and the deck will be slippery due to the oil. .

2)A person should be assigned to be responsible for on-site inspection of the oil boom that is being recovered, and records should be made, and the damaged ones should be repaired.

3)Appropriate amount of linoleum felt should be provided on the deck to clean up the dirty oil spilled on the deck in time.

4)If the oil stains brought by the recycling process will make the deck extremely slippery and cause safety hazards, the operation can be suspended, and the recycling operation can be continued after proper cleaning.


3. Cleaning the boom

Generally, oil booms that are repeatedly used for oil spill containment operations do not need to be cleaned. However, if the oil boom is used to protect non-oil-contaminated areas or transfer to shoreline cleaning operations and the used oil boom is left unused or needs to be stored in storage, it needs to be cleaned.


When cleaning the oil boom, it should be cleaned with a special cleaning device while recycling. If there is no special cleaning device, the oil boom can be recycled first, and then cleaned on the shore, but a cleaning area should be set up to avoid the overflow of cleaned sewage and secondary pollution.


To manually clean the oil fence, first use a scraper (preferably wood) to gently scrape off the thick oil layer that sticks to the surface of the oil fence, then wash it with warm water or use a dispersant brush, and finally wipe it off with an absorbent felt. In good weather conditions, 6 to 12 workers a day can clean the 305m oil boom.


Use the oil boom cleaning device, the cleaning angle between the spray gun and the oil boom surface should be less than 45°, and the water temperature used should not be overheated, as long as the surface oil can be removed, the lower the temperature, the better, to avoid causing the foreskin of the oil boom Premature aging.


The oil boom is finally rinsed with fresh water and placed in a cool place to dry before putting it in the inventory.


4. Storage and maintenance of oil boom

The storage and maintenance of the oil boom is directly related to the ability to quickly respond to oil spill emergency and effectively implement containment operations. In order to ensure rapid response, the storage location of the oil boom should be as close as possible to the docks, operating points and sensitive resource protection areas, and the storage location of the oil boom should be convenient for vehicles and ships to enter and exit. For oil booms stored outdoors, ensure that the storage place has good drainage and pay attention to insect pests, moisture, and avoid direct sunlight; when stored indoors, they should also be moisture-proof and well-ventilated, and take necessary measures in advance according to the situation. Take measures to prevent pests (such as spreading rodenticide, etc.); oil booms that need to be folded for storage should be placed on a shelf and no other items should be stacked on it, to avoid excessive pressure causing deformation of the oil fence, and stack them regularly The oil boom should be unfolded for inspection, and the original folding marks should be avoided when refolding; if the oil boom needs to be stored on the reel, the oil boom should be prevented from being twisted during the winding process, and the wound oil boom should be regularly Expand all, and recycle it after inspection. The maintenance of the oil boom mainly refers to the maintenance after daily maintenance and recycling operations. The maintenance after the recovery operation is mainly to check whether the oil boom is damaged, whether the accessories are complete or whether it needs to be replaced and repaired; daily maintenance generally checks whether the oil boom is worn out due to pulling and other loading and unloading reasons. Cracks, fiber aging, connector corrosion or damage, and carry out necessary maintenance and replacement; for oil booms that have been placed in waters for a long time, regular maintenance should also be carried out. Generally, the oil boom should be dragged ashore regularly according to specific conditions , Remove the marine organisms and other adherents attached to the surface of the oil boom; no matter what kind of maintenance and maintenance is carried out, it is necessary to make detailed records and arrange inspection and maintenance items according to the records to ensure that the oil is contained within a certain period of time. All the contents involved in the boom can be inspected and maintained at one time, so that the boom is always in a good standby state.
